As a Principal Project Manager, you’ll lead complex Dynamics 365 projects while partnering closely with clients as a trusted advisor. You’ll help clients navigate trade‑offs, manage risk, and achieve business outcomes across enterprise and corporate-level implementations.

A Day in the Life

  • Successfully leads and manages large and/or complex Dynamics 365 projects, including multi‑workload implementations including integrations, ISVs, and AI requirements, with a strong focus on client outcomes and value realization
  • Acts as a trusted advisor and thought partner to client leadership, guiding strategic decisions and helping clients navigate trade‑offs related to scope, timeline, cost, and risk
  • Provides day‑to‑day and strategic leadership over project teams, balancing execution with proactive risk identification and outcome protection
  • Leads project planning, monitoring, and reporting with an emphasis on anticipating risk, surfacing options, and framing decisions in terms of impact and trade‑offs
  • Builds and maintains strong, trust‑based relationships with client PMs and senior stakeholders
  • Proactively identifies risks, dependencies, and delivery challenges before they materialize, and recommends mitigation strategies
  • Challenges scope, sequencing, and delivery approach when necessary to protect business outcomes and delivery quality
  • Adjusts communication style and level of detail based on audience and intent
  • Anticipates organizational change impacts and helps prepare client stakeholders for adoption and transition
  • Uses escalation strategically and early to protect outcomes and remove blockers
  • Identifies opportunities to improve client outcomes beyond the original plan
  • Organizes and facilitates steering committees and governance forums focused on decision‑making and risk management
  • Maintains ownership of project financials, forecasts, and delivery health
  • Manages issues and escalations with professionalism and strong interpersonal judgment
  • Mentors and coaches junior PMs and coordinators
